CALIFORNIA – A 45-year-old dermatologist, Yue ‘Emily’ Yu, who allegedly poisoned her husband for several weeks with Drano liquid drain cleaner last year in 2022, was indicted Wednesday, April 5. A grand jury indicted her on three counts. of poisoning and one count of domestic battery with bodily harm.

In April 2022, Yu’s husband, Dr. Jack Chen, a radiologist, began noticing a different taste in her tea. He then set up cameras through which he caught her in the act. Videos from July 11, July 18, and July 25, 2022 captured her wife pouring liquid drain cleaner into her tea. Chen collected the tea samples and turned them over to the Irvine Police Department, CBS News reports. Chen suffered stomach ulcers as a result of the alleged poisoning.

Yue ‘Emily’ Yu  indicted of poisoning husband

Chen filed for divorce before the incident after 10 years of marriage and also filed to keep Yu away from her two elementary-age children, the New York Post reports. He accused Yu and her mother-in-law in August 2022 of abusing him and her two children. He said: “Two-year-old Emily and Amy were verbally then physically abusive, which intensified as they got older. They are verbally and physically abusive to me.”

However, in a statement, Scott Simmons, Yue Yu’s attorney, said her client’s husband made false statements to obtain a divorce from her. He said: “If you thought you were being poisoned, would you go to a divorce lawyer before going to the hospital or the police? Drano is not an undercover poison agent. It has a strong odor and taste and is highly caustic. Dr. Yu looks forward to her day in court when she finally finds out the truth,” stated KTLA 5.

Yu was arrested in August 2022, but was later released on $30,000 bail. However, she was indicted on April 5. Speaking of this, Orange County District Attorney Todd Spitzer said: “Our homes should be where we feel safest. However, a licensed medical professional took advantage of her husband’s daily rituals to torment him by systematically giving him a Drano-like substance in her tea with the intention of causing him pain and suffering.”

While Chen’s attorney, Steve Hittleman, has exclusively reported that Chen now has full custody of the two children, Yue Yu has scheduled visitation rights. Hittleman said: “Making sure there is a chance for justice to be done. This is the next step in resolving this horrible turn of events.
